<br /> How many cars have you owned over the course of your life? Three? Five? Ten? How about 135, and all from the same company? It may seem like unfathomable customer loyalty, but that's just what one Herr Klaus Hammerschmidt has done in taking delivery of his latest Bavarian motor work. You might think he'd mark the occasion with a new 135i, but instead the 73-year-old retiree picked up a brand-new M6 coupe, complete with the Competition Package, from the flagship BMW Welt showroom in Munich.<br /> <br /> Hammerschmidt says he began driving when he was just 12, taking the wheel of his dad's car while papa worked the pedals. His first car was a 1800ti in 1963, and since then he's had 26 M cars, 29 Alpinas and another 80 standard BMWs. Before you go pulling out the calculator, that works out to an average of nearly 3 new cars every year. Not a bad way to spend a lifetime's earnings if you have the means. <p>The BMW 6-Series is a lot of car, and while the 5.0-liter V10 in the M6 does a remarkable job of moving it around, critics have said it could use some help. Reports now indicate that the M division is giving it some help in the form of a new Competition Package.</p>
<p>The pseudo-CSL gets a new active suspension and a ride height lowered by 12mm up front and 10mm in the back, along with new wheels and a new front hood to set it apart from the standard model. With or without the Competition Package, however, the entire M6 range (coupe and convertible) gets new side mirrors, a new electronics package controlled by the revised iDrive system and a new shade of black for the exterior. While we're not sure the new option pack would prompt us to take the M6 Competition Package racing as its name suggests, it does make the big sports-coupe that much more tempting. </p>
